Найти тему

Low-code разработка: происхождение и отличия от no-code и традиционных подходов

Оглавление

Low-code подход к разработке программного обеспечения зародился в ответ на ускоренное развитие технологического сектора и растущую потребность в быстрой и эффективной разработке сервисов. В основе этого подхода лежит стремление упростить процесс создания сервисов путем минимизации необходимости в ручном кодировании.

Идея облегченной разработки не нова. Еще в 90-х годах XX века появились инструменты визуального программирования, позволяющие создавать приложения с помощью перетаскивания объектов на форме. Однако концепция low-code получила свое распространение и стала популярной только в последнее десятилетие благодаря усложнению IT-инфраструктур и росту облачных решений.

Low-code отличается от no-code подхода, хотя часто даже специалисты используют эти понятия как синонимы. Подход low-code предоставляет разработчикам возможность внедрять и настраивать код там, где это необходимо, обеспечивая гибкость в интеграции и кастомизации приложений. В то время как no-code платформы ориентированы на пользователей без опыта программирования, предоставляя им интуитивные инструменты для создания приложений без написания кода.

В современной индустрии IT существует множество платформ, призванных упростить и ускорить процесс разработки. К примеру, среди популярных для бизнеса low-code решений выделяются OutSystems, который предлагает инструменты для быстрой разработки сложных корпоративных приложений, Appian, фокусирующийся на автоматизации бизнес-процессов, Mendix, позволяющий интегрировать приложения с различными облачными сервисами и системами IoT. Можно найти и много других примеров, подходящих под конкретные задачи. С другой стороны, no-code платформы, такие как Wix, предоставляют возможность создавать профессиональные веб-сайты без опыта в кодировании, Bubble упрощает проектирование веб-приложений, а Webflow дает графические инструменты для создания кастомных сайтов. Выбор конкретного решения зависит от специфических потребностей и задач бизнеса.

Традиционная разработка

Традиционная разработка программного обеспечения с написанием кода требует глубоких знаний языков программирования и долгого процесса разработки. В отличие от этого, low-code позволяет ускорить процесс создания приложений, делая его более доступным для более широкого круга людей, не обладающих глубокими знаниями в программировании.

Low-code разработка

Low-code разработка представляет собой эффективный ответ на потребности современного быстро меняющегося мира в быстрой и гибкой разработке сервисов. Она мостик между традиционными методами разработки и no-code решениями, и предоставляет компаниям и разработчикам инструменты, необходимые для успешного адаптирования к новым технологическим вызовам.

Если хотите лучше ориентироваться в будущем разработки и аналитики для бизнеса, приглашаем вас в наш Телеграм канал. У нас скучно не бывает!